AgInSe/sub 2/ single crystals

1988 
Single crystals of AgInSe/sub 2/ were grown by the Bridgman-Stockbarger method in a double-zone furnace. The temperatures in the top and bottom zones equaled 1220 and 790 K, respectively. This made it possible to create a temperature gradient approx.0.4 K/m in the crystallization zone. The rate of propagation of the crystallization front was chosen equal to 4 x 10/sup -4/ m/h. After passage through the temperature gradient zone the crystals were annealed in the bottom zone for one week. The single-crystalline ingots grown were carefully studied by methods of x-ray diffraction analysis, emission spectroscopy, transmission electron microscopy, and electron-probe microanalysis.
